Home to the renowned Williams College and Clark Art Institute, this Berkshires gem offers cultural richness beyond its small-town size. Catch a summer theater festival performance, then hike nearby trails where the Appalachian and Taconic ranges meet for spectacular valley views.

The hottest months are usually July and August with an average temp of 65°F, while the coldest months are January and February with an average of 27°F. The snowiest months in Williamstown are January, March, February, and November, with each month seeing an average of 7 inches of snowfall.
